Add initial Colibri VF61 support based off Timesys' implementation for
Freescale's Vybrid Tower System TWR-VF65GS10:
- New machine ID.
- Default UART_A on SCI0.
- ESDHC2 only.
- 8-bit NAND.
- No quad SPI.
- FEC1 only.
- Enabled command line editing.
- PLL5 based RMII clocking (e.g. no external crystal).
- UART_A, UART_B and UART_C I/O muxing.
- Increase the available space for the U-Boot binary to half a megabyte
by booting from gfxRAM rather than sysRAM0.
- Integrate factory configuration block handling for hardware version,
MAC address and serial number to be passed to Linux.
- The U-Boot environment is stored in NAND flash.
- Fix long standing boot hang issue introduced by Freescale's Vybrid
1.1 silicon.
- Proper 256 MB Nanya DDR3 RAM timings.
Tested on early Colibri VF61 prototypes V1.0b and V1.0c using SD card
(mandatory for initial loading) as well as NAND boot.

Add initial Colibri VF50 support based off Timesys' implementation for
Freescale's Vybrid Tower System TWR-VF65GS10:
- New machine ID.
- Default UART_A on SCI0.
- ESDHC2 only.
- 8-bit NAND.
- No quad SPI.
- FEC1 only.
- Enabled command line editing.
- PLL5 based RMII clocking (e.g. no external crystal).
- UART_A, UART_B and UART_C I/O muxing.
Tested on early Colibri VF50 prototypes V1.0a using SD card (mandatory
for initial loading) as well as NAND boot.

This patch adds the minimal support for OMAP5. The platform and machine
specific headers and sources updated for OMAP5430.
OMAP5430 is Texas Instrument's SOC based on ARM Cortex-A15 SMP architecture.
It's a dual core SOC with GIC used for interrupt handling and SCU for cache
coherency.
Also moved some part of code from the basic platform support that can be made
common for OMAP4/5. Rest is kept out seperately. The same approach is followed
for clocks and emif support in the subsequent patches.
